# Env vars — Template Rendering Perf (Plumage)

Quick context for reviewers: the Plumage renderer got slow once partial caching landed, so we added RENDER_CACHE_TTL and PARTIAL_WARMUP to tune it. Both have defaults in .env.sample — tweak locally, don't commit changes. Profiling uploads go to the Gaugewell dashboard, which is authenticated. To make the perf checks pass locally, put your Gaugewell upload token on the next line.

secret setting of yagef-baweg: RELAY_SECRET29=cb53deb59a49ed54d9f43599b54ca

Capacity note for the ValidatorKit plugin loader: each registered validator plugin holds a worker slot, and we've seen spikes when Brillmere's nightly imports hit. Nothing scary yet, but we should bump headroom before the 4.2 cut rather than after. Rena signed off on the numbers below. The tuning constants we plan to ship are as follows.

tuning constants:
BUDGETS = {
    "druath": 240,
    "lamwyn": 180,
    "silael": 275,
}

Hello plugin authors,

Next Thursday, Corbexa will run a disaster-recovery drill for the RestockRoute vending-machine restock planner. During the failover window, plugin callbacks will be replayed against the standby scheduler, so please ensure your handlers are idempotent and tolerate duplicate route assignments. No customer restock data will be altered. To re-register your plugin against the standby environment during the drill, authenticate with the recovery passphrase provided below.

vault phrase of hahip-tajeg = quenax-briath-briax